When returning District 62 students arrived at school, many of them were greeted by new teachers and staff. District-wide, forty-three new teaching staff were hired this year.

Out of the 43 teachers hired, 58% hold bachelor’s degrees and 42% hold master’s degrees. The majority of the new teachers attended Loyola University, National Louis University, the University of Illinois, and Northern Illinois University. With a record number of retirees, many of the new staff replaced these positions. The greatest need was in Special Education with 15 new staff added including Speech Pathologists, School Psychologists, and Social Workers. The next greatest need for staff was at the middle school level with 14 staff added.
